About this book

This wide-ranging volume surveys the immense impact that quantitative methods have had on the development of modern biological and medical science. Beginning with the contribution of the Ancient Greek philosophers, the author then traces the development of fundamental ideas from there to the present day. He shows how mathematics and statistics have profoundly influenced the emergence of key ideas and theories.
